New York Style Asiago Cheesesteak

  1. Mix wine, tarragon, and garlic together.
  2. Pour over steak in either a small container or plastic bag that seals in order to marinade for two to four hours.
  3. When steak is finished marinading, discard liquid, and sprinkle each side of the steak with an even amount of salt and pepper.
  4. Grill steak on medium high heat for 7 to 8 minutes on each side until medium rare to medium.
  5. Remove steak from grill, and let sit while completing the next steps.
  6. Heat olive oil in a pan and saute onion, pepper, and garlic until soft.
  7. Add Syrah wine to onion, pepper, and garlic. Add tarragon, salt, and Worcestershire sauce. Cook until most of the wine cooks off and little liquid is left.
  8. Slice steak into thin strips. Mix into onion, pepper, and garlic mixture.
  9. Open up garlic loaf and heat on the grill until slightly toasted.
  10. Once heated, remove from grill, and lay Asiago cheese slices on inside of top portion.
  11. Lay steak mixture on bottom portion.
  12. Close loaf, slice into four servings, and enjoy!
